Chatham Charter High School

Chatham Charter High School is a charter school in Siler City, North Carolina. The school opened in August 2013 with 115 students, and will add a freshman class every year until the school reaches around 200 students in the high school. The school sits on 39 acres and a 43,000 square foot facility. The education for grades 912 is a middle college model; students take core classes as 9th and 10th graders, then take courses through Central Carolina Community College as 11th and 12th graders. This results in students earning a large number of transferable college credits while simultaneously earning their high school diplomas.

History

Chatham Charter was founded in 1996, as one of the first schools to receive a charter from the state.

Athletics

Chatham Charter is a 1A Independent for the North Carolina High School Athletic Association for the 201415 year, and will move to a conference in 2015–16. School sports include men's and women's cross country, men's and women's soccer, men's and women's basketball, softball, baseball, men's and women's tennis, golf, and volleyball.
